Redistributing toner 1 2 3 When toner is low, faded or light areas appear on the printed page. You might be able to temporarily improve print quality by redistributing the toner, which means that you might be able to finish the current print job before replacing the toner cartridge. Note You will feel some resistance when you open the toner door. Opening the toner door conveniently lifts the toner cartridge for removal. 1 Open the toner door, and remove the toner cartridge from the printer. CAUTION To prevent damage, do not expose the toner cartridge to light. Cover it with a sheet of paper. 2 To redistribute the toner, gently shake the toner cartridge from side to side. CAUTION If toner gets on your clothing, wipe it off with a dry cloth and wash the clothing in cold water. Hot water sets toner into the fabric. 3 Reinsert the toner cartridge into the printer, and close the toner door. If the print is still light, install a new toner cartridge.
